Contextual Bandit Algorithms — AI for Marketers

Contextual Bandit Algorithms: What is it?

A Contextual Bandit Algorithm is a type of reinforcement learning algorithm that’s particularly suited for situations where there’s a need to balance exploration (trying out new actions) and exploitation (sticking with the best-known action). It extends the classic multi-armed bandit problem by considering the context in which actions are taken.

What are some use cases for Marketers?

Marketers can use Contextual Bandit Algorithms for personalized marketing campaigns where they need to learn the best action (e.g., which product to recommend) based on the context (e.g., user demographics, browsing history).

What are the advantages for Marketers who understand Contextual Bandit Algorithms?

Contextual Bandit Algorithms can help improve the effectiveness of personalized marketing campaigns by learning and adapting to user preferences over time.

What are the challenges related to Contextual Bandit Algorithms?

Implementing Contextual Bandit Algorithms requires a good understanding of reinforcement learning principles and can be computationally intensive.

Examples of applying Contextual Bandit Algorithms for Marketers

Online news platforms can use contextual bandit algorithms to personalize news article recommendations. The context can be user characteristics, and the actions are the various articles that can be recommended.

The future of Contextual Bandit Algorithms

The use of Contextual Bandit Algorithms in marketing is expected to grow, driven by the increasing demand for effective personalization in real-time.
